Tyson Fury’s promoter says Usyk fight WILL be made and tells Anthony Joshua he can still have shot at Gypsy King

AN undisputed heavyweight fight WILL take place between Tyson Fury and Oleksandr Usyk, promoter Frank Warren has revealed.

Usyk, 35, defeated Anthony Joshua by split decision in Saudi Arabia on Saturday night in a repeat of his win over the Brit 11 months earlier.

Fury revealed at the weekend that he is open to fighting Usyk

Usyk beat Joshua for a second time in 11 months in Saudi Arabia on Saturday night

The victory paves the way for a mouth-watering clash with WBC champion Fury – who confirmed at the weekend that he is open to coming out of retirement for the Usyk bout.

And Warren, who has promoted Fury since his comeback in 2018, insists the clash with the Ukrainian will be made.

Speaking to the BBC, he said: “He and Usyk would be a really good fight.

“It’s a fight that I think will be made because both teams would like to see that happen.

“Usyk said after the fight that it’s the only fight he’s interested in, and it’s certainly the same case with Tyson.

“It’s just a matter of where it will generate the most income because it’s a unique fight, a historic fight.

“It’s the first time for God knows how long that the four belts are on the line.

“Both fighters are undefeated. The whole world of boxing will be captivated by this fight.”

Warren also claimed that Joshua can still earn a shot against Fury, providing he bounces back from the two losses to Usyk.

He added: “If AJ manages to get a couple of wins under his belt – and I believe Tyson will beat Usyk – that may be a fight to be made.

“But AJ’s got to re-establish himself before you can even think about fights like that.”

Both Fury and Usyk are undefeated as professionals – Fury in 33 bouts and Usyk in 20.

Meanwhile, Joshua now has three defeats on his record – the two losses to Usyk coming after Andy Ruiz Jr stunned the world by KOing him back in 2019.
